Output 94572af567feeb35adeef18b58b10a3334d9133b456852607d0b27722a73081e:1

value
40094
script pubkey
OP_0 OP_PUSHBYTES_20 ec3fd22732bdbb7990fab7ec49c1dd90ffaa89e1
address
tb1qaslayfejhkahny86klkynswajrl64z0pwdwz8p
transaction
94572af567feeb35adeef18b58b10a3334d9133b456852607d0b27722a73081e
confirmations
45560
spent
true